| Product Description | Recombinant CHO-K1 cells stably overexpress human calcitonin receptor (CTR) on the surface and contain high levels of G protein Gαs and luciferase to couple with the receptor in downstream signaling pathways. |
| Culture Properties | Adherent |
| Stability | Stable through more than 20 passages without significant changes in assay performance or expression profile. |
| Size | Two vials of frozen cells (>1×106 per vial in 1 mL) |
| Storage | Store cells in liquid nitrogen immediately upon receipt. Thaw and recover cells within one year from the date received. |
| Culture Medium | Ham’s F-12K (Kaighn’s), 10% FBS, 100 μg/ml Hygromycin B (Cat. No. 10687010, Life Technologies), 400 μg/ml Geneticin (Cat. No. 10131-027, Life Technologies) |
| Complete Growth Medium | Ham’s F-12K (Kaighn’s), 10% FBS |
| Freeze Medium-DATA | 45% Ham’s F-12 K (Kaighn’s) (Cat. No. 21127, Life Technologies), 45% FBS (Cat. No. 10099-141, Life Technologies), 10% DMSO (Cat. No. D2650, Sigma) |
Figure 1. Amylin-induced luciferase expression in CHO-K1/CRE-Luc/CTR cells. After stimulation by agonist amylin (Cat. No. HY-P1464, MCE), the cells are determined with Fire-Lumi™ Luciferase Assay System (Cat. No. L00877C-100, Genscript) and the relative luminescence units (RLU) were recorded by plate reader (Pherastar, BMG). The RLU were plotted against the log of the cumulative doses of amylin (Mean ± SEM, n = 3). The EC50 of rat amylin on cells was 6.05 nM.
Notes:
EC50 value is calculated with four parameter logistic equation:
Y=Bottom + (Top-Bottom) / (1+10^ ((LogEC50-X)*Hill Slope))
X is the logarithm of concentration. Y is the response.
Y is RLU and starts at Bottom and goes to Top along a sigmoid curve.

Figure 2. Dose dependent stimulation of intracellular cAMP accumulation upon treatment with rat amylin in CHO-K1/CRE-Luc/CTR cells. d2 acceptor fluorophore-labeled cAMP (Cat. No. 62AM4PEB; Revvity) and intracellular cAMP in CHO-K1/CRE-Luc/CTR cells competitively bind with Europium Cryptate-labeled anti-cAMP antibody. The FRET signal decreases as the intracellular cAMP concentration rises and was measured by plate reader (Pherastar, BMG). The EC50 of rat amylin on CHO-K1/CRE-Luc/CTR cells was 97.23 nM. »
